Course Details

Introduction to Quantum Machine Learning (QML): Gain an understanding of the fundamental concepts of quantum computing and machine learning, and how they can be combined to create powerful new algorithms for data analysis and decision making.
Quantum Computing Fundamentals: Learn about qubits, quantum gates, superposition, entanglement, and other key principles of quantum mechanics that underpin the development of quantum algorithms.
Machine Learning Concepts: Explore the basics of machine learning, including supervised and unsupervised learning, regression, classification, clustering, and neural networks.
Quantum Machine Learning Algorithms: Study the latest research on quantum machine learning algorithms, including quantum support vector machines, quantum neural networks, and quantum recommendation systems.
Quantum Data Encoding and Preprocessing: Understand how to encode classical data into quantum states, and learn techniques for preprocessing quantum data to improve the performance of machine learning algorithms.
Quantum Machine Learning Hardware and Software: Get familiar with the latest hardware and software platforms for quantum computing, including IBM Q, Google Quantum AI, Rigetti Computing, and D-Wave Systems.
Quantum Machine Learning Applications: Explore real-world use cases and applications of quantum machine learning in finance, healthcare, logistics, and other industries.
Quantum Machine Learning Ethics and Security: Examine the ethical and security implications of quantum machine learning, including data privacy, bias, and cybersecurity.
Quantum Machine Learning Roadmap and Future Directions: Discuss the future directions of quantum machine learning research, including the development of new algorithms, hardware platforms, and applications.

Let's explore the top five roles in this exciting field: 1. **Data Scientist**: As a crucial part of any ML team, data scientists leverage their statistical and computational skills to extract meaningful insights from complex datasets. Their role involves data cleaning, exploration, and visualization, as well as the application of various ML algorithms. 2. **Machine Learning Engineer**: With a strong focus on ML model development and deployment, machine learning engineers bridge the gap between data scientists and software engineers. They design and implement ML systems, ensuring scalability, performance, and reliability. 3. **Quantum Computing Engineer**: A relatively new role, quantum computing engineers specialize in programming and optimizing quantum computers. They apply principles of quantum mechanics to design novel algorithms and develop applications for these groundbreaking machines. 4. **Software Engineer**: Software engineers play a vital role in developing and maintaining the infrastructure required for Quantum ML applications. From designing user interfaces to creating robust backend systems, their expertise ensures seamless integration of ML models into real-world products. 5. **Data Analyst**: Tasked with interpreting complex datasets, data analysts communicate their findings to various stakeholders, enabling informed decision-making. They often work closely with data scientists and engineers to identify trends, develop visualizations, and generate reports.
